Residents of Desa Cijayanti in Babakan Madang, Bogor Regency, West Java, are grappling with the aftermath of severe flooding after the Cijayanti River breached its banks on Sunday, May 24, 2026. Intense rainfall led to the river's overflow, submerging numerous homes and causing significant damage.
The Badan Penanggulangan Bencana Daerah (BPBD) of Bogor Regency reported that the deluge inundated 138 houses in the village. In addition to the widespread flooding, one house completely collapsed due to the force of the overflowing river. The images from the scene show residents salvaging belongings from their damaged homes and community members assisting in the cleanup efforts.
Despite the extensive property damage, including the destruction of one residence, the incident fortunately resulted in no loss of life. Emergency response teams and local villagers were observed working together to clear debris and help those affected by the floodwaters. The focus is now on recovery and rebuilding efforts in the affected areas of Desa Cijayanti.
